/**
* Browser Environment Tests
* Tests Brainy functionality in browser environment as a consumer would use it
* @vitest-environment jsdom
*/
import { describe, it, expect, beforeAll, vi } from 'vitest'
/**
* Helper function to create a 384-dimensional vector for testing
* @param primaryIndex The index to set to 1.0, all other indices will be 0.0
* @returns A 384-dimensional vector with a single 1.0 value at the specified index
*/
function createTestVector(primaryIndex: number = 0): number[] {
const vector = new Array(384).fill(0)
vector[primaryIndex % 384] = 1.0
return vector
}

it.skip(
'should handle text data with embeddings',
async () => {
// Skip this test due to ONNX Runtime compatibility issues with jsdom
// The Node.js ONNX Runtime backend has strict Float32Array type checking
// that conflicts with jsdom's simulated browser environment
// This works fine in real browsers, just not in the jsdom test environment
const db = new brainy.BrainyData({
embeddingFunction: brainy.createEmbeddingFunction(),
metric: 'cosine',
storage: {
forceMemoryStorage: true
}
})
await db.init()
// Add text items as a consumer would
await db.addItem('Hello browser world', { id: 'greeting' })
await db.addItem('Goodbye browser world', { id: 'farewell' })
// Search with text
const results = await db.search('Hi there', { limit: 1 })
expect(results).toBeDefined()
expect(results.length).toBeGreaterThan(0)
expect(results[0].metadata).toHaveProperty('id')
},
globalThis.testUtils?.timeout || 30000
)
